mirror of
https://git.haproxy.org/git/haproxy.git/
synced 2025-08-10 00:57:02 +02:00
[CLEANUP] http: remove a remaining impossible condition
This test was there before we had the CLOSING and CLOSED states. It makes no sense now.
This commit is contained in:
parent
477ecd8627
commit
bddaa4a2f7
@ -3347,17 +3347,6 @@ int http_request_forward_body(struct session *s, struct buffer *req, int an_bit)
|
|||||||
if (req->to_forward)
|
if (req->to_forward)
|
||||||
return 0;
|
return 0;
|
||||||
|
|
||||||
/* we're sending the last bits of request, the server's response
|
|
||||||
* is expected in a short time. Most often the first read is enough
|
|
||||||
* to bring all the headers, so we're preparing the response buffer
|
|
||||||
* to read the response now. Note that we should probably move that
|
|
||||||
* to a more appropriate place.
|
|
||||||
*/
|
|
||||||
if (txn->rsp.msg_state == HTTP_MSG_RPBEFORE) {
|
|
||||||
s->rep->flags &= ~BF_DONT_READ;
|
|
||||||
s->rep->flags |= BF_READ_DONTWAIT;
|
|
||||||
}
|
|
||||||
|
|
||||||
/* nothing left to forward */
|
/* nothing left to forward */
|
||||||
if (txn->flags & TX_REQ_TE_CHNK)
|
if (txn->flags & TX_REQ_TE_CHNK)
|
||||||
msg->msg_state = HTTP_MSG_DATA_CRLF;
|
msg->msg_state = HTTP_MSG_DATA_CRLF;
|
||||||
|
Loading…
Reference in New Issue
Block a user